Digitalising accounting automation: what actually works
Accounting digitalisation always follows the same path: capture documents at the source (photo or PDF upload), let automatic recognition extract supplier, amount, date and VAT, approve the proposed entries, then archive each document linked to its entry. Every step removes a re-keying — and therefore an error source.
The selection criterion for a tool is not the length of its feature list but the robustness of the daily flow: reliable bank imports, VAT computed correctly (8.1 / 2.6 / 3.8%), a complete audit trail from document to entry, and a clean export for the auditor or fiduciary. Everything else is secondary.

A well-structured SME chart of accounts
Shareholder current accounts demand strict hygiene: every private withdrawal documented, interest at the rates accepted by the tax administration, and a clean-up at closing.
In an SME in Belprahon, the chart of accounts is also a delegation tool: clear posting rules let a non-accountant prepare most entries without error.

Outsource accounting automation or keep it in-house?
Outsourcing accounting automation to a fiduciary frees up time and secures compliance; keeping it in-house preserves a continuous view and costs less in fees. The best answer is often hybrid: the company captures and digitises as it goes, the fiduciary supervises, closes the books and represents the company before the authorities.
For accounting automation, the internal-external duo works when both sides see the same file: same entries, same documents, same deadlines. Misunderstandings are born from parallel copies.

What are the current Swiss VAT rates?
Since 1 January 2024: 8.1% (standard), 2.6% (reduced — for example food and medicines) and 3.8% (accommodation). Returns must be filed and paid within 60 days after the period ends (quarterly under the effective method, semi-annually under the net tax rate method). Which documents should be prepared for the year-end closing?
Bank and cash statements at the closing date, the inventory of stock and work in progress, final AHV/LPP/accident settlements, contracts signed or amended during the year, invoices straddling two years and the detail of accruals.
